Create Halloween Decoration Tips

Get your home Halloween-ready with these easy DIY spider web decoration tips!

  • Easy Materials: Use black yarn or thick string to create simple spider webs. They're cheap and look great!
  • Sticky Situation: Use tape or small adhesive hooks to attach your webs to walls, doorways, or furniture. This keeps them secure and easy to remove.
  • Glow in the Dark: Make your spider webs stand out by adding some glow-in-the-dark paint or using glow sticks. This adds an eerie effect, especially at night.
  • Spider Accessories: Add plastic spiders or other creepy crawlies to your webs for extra spookiness. You can even get creative and use small toy bats or skeletons for a fun twist.
